Iced Orange Cappucino
|
Directions:
Place orange zest in bottom of coffee pot. Brew coffee, using cold water and espresso; cool to room temperature. Strain coffee and discard orange zest; stir in NutraSweet Spoonful and milk. Refrigerate until chilled.
Pour cappuccino into chilled tall glasses; spoon small dollop of whipped topping on each and sprinkle with cocoa, nutmeg or cinnamon.
NOTE: Cappuccino can be frozen in ice cube trays; the cubes can be used with cappuccino so it will not be diluted. Also, the ice cubes can be processed in a blender to make cappuccino slush.
Recipe makes about eight, 8-ounce servings.
Nutrition information per serving:
Calories: 45
Carbohydrates: 7g
Protein: 3g
Fat: 1g
Saturated Fat: trace
Cholesterol: 2mg
Sodium: 55mg
Food exchange per serving:1/2 skim milk or 1/2 starch
